Latchways® Guided Type Fall Arrest (GTFA) Devices - How to Examine, Repair and Certify
This module is for those who are required to maintain Latchways GTFA equipment (LadderLatch®, TowerLatch® and ClimbLatch® devices) in an operational condition.

Course Contents
- Condition a given GTFA device through the process of examination, repair, disposal and recertification.
- Understand the requirement for the periodic examination of a given GTFA device.
- Understand the concept of use and concept of employment of the GTFA device models.
- Identify and use all associated tooling and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) required to examine and repair a given GTFA device.
- Understand the components and their function of a given GTFA device.
- Perform a periodic examination on a given GTFA device.
- Perform a level two repair task on a given GTFA device.
Learning Outcomes
Delegates will be able to examine, use, repair and recertify a Latchways GTFA device.
Course Assessment
- Practical assessment
